When this happens, your printer will stop working, and you will see alternating flashing red lights (the power and paper/ink lights) alongside a service error message on your computer screen. This guide explains how to safely use the Epson L222 Adjustment Program (Resetter Tool) to fix this issue and restore your printer to full functionality. Understanding the "Service Required" Error
Every time the printer performs a cleaning cycle, the digital counter increases. Once this counter reaches a pre-programmed maximum limit (100% capacity), the printer goes into a hard lockout state. It will refuse to print, scan, or copy, and the power and paper/ink lights will flash alternately.
